In preparation for the theatrical release of Diary of a Wimpy Kid: Dog Days on August 3, Twentieth Century Fox Consumer Products has launched a national retail campaign with Walmart, making the chain a “One Stop Wimpy Shop.” More than 2,500 stores nationwide are now carrying a full range of Wimpy Kid products, including exclusive merchandise that can only be purchased at Walmart. The program will remain in store through August 28.

In addition to all of Jeff Kinney's books, including updated tie-in The Wimpy Kid Movie Diary: How Greg Heffley Went Hollywood, a line of related accessories will also be featured at Walmart. Andrews + Blaine and Trends International is bringing out bookmarks and book lights , and Cardinal Industries has a mini prank kit, complete with moldy cheese and flies in ice. Another Walmart exclusive: a DVD set with the first two movies, Diary of a Wimpy Kid and Diary of a Wimpy Kid: Rodrick Rules.

But it's not all about the big screen for Kinney's hapless character. On November 13, Amulet Books will publish the seventh title in the series, Diary of a Wimpy Kid: The Third Wheel. In this newest installment, which will have a 6.5 million first printing, Greg tries to get a date for the Valentine's Day dance.
